Le marché du jeu mobile a explosé : plus de la moitié des joueurs de casino accèdent aux machines à sous depuis un smartphone ou une tablette. Cette évolution impose aux opérateurs de penser leurs produits comme des applications natives, capables de profiter de la puissance graphique des appareils iOS et Android tout en respectant les exigences de vitesse et de sécurité. Parallèlement, les jackpots progressifs, avec leurs gains qui peuvent atteindre plusieurs millions d’euros, restent le principal moteur d’acquisition. Un joueur qui voit le compteur du jackpot grimper à chaque spin est incité à rester plus longtemps, à miser davantage et à partager l’expérience sur les réseaux.
Un exemple de plateforme qui a déjà intégré ces principes est le casino en ligne. Sur ce site, on trouve une interface fluide, des temps de chargement maîtrisés et une conformité stricte aux standards européens, ce qui montre qu’une approche unifiée est possible.
Dans la suite, nous décortiquerons six axes : l’architecture technique, l’UX spécifique aux jackpots, les stratégies d’acquisition et de rétention, la conformité légale, l’analyse comparative des performances entre iOS et Android, et enfin une feuille de route de développement. Chaque partie propose des recommandations concrètes pour transformer votre offre mobile en un véritable aimant à gros lots.
1. Architecture technique d’une application de casino cross‑plateforme
Le choix du framework constitue le premier levier. React Native séduit par son écosystème JavaScript et sa capacité à partager jusqu’à 90 % du code entre les deux OS, idéal pour des équipes déjà familières avec le web. Flutter, quant à lui, propose un rendu graphique vectoriel ultra‑rapide grâce à son moteur Skia, ce qui se traduit par des animations de jackpot fluides même sur les téléphones d’entrée de gamme. Unity reste la référence pour les jeux 3D ou les titres nécessitant des effets de particules lourds, mais il impose une empreinte mémoire plus importante.
| Critère | React Native | Flutter | Unity |
|---|---|---|---|
| Temps de développement | Moyen | Rapide | Long |
| Performances graphiques | Bon | Excellent | Très élevé |
| Taille du binaire | 30 Mo | 40 Mo | 150 Mo |
| Communauté | Très large | En croissance | Spécialisée |
La gestion des API doit être centralisée via un gateway qui normalise les réponses des fournisseurs de jeux (RTP, volatilité, jackpot). Les services de paiement – Apple Pay, Google Pay, cartes tokenisées – sont intégrés par des SDK certifiés PCI‑DSS, garantissant que les données de carte ne transitent jamais en clair.
Sur le plan de la sécurité, chaque appel aux serveurs de jeu est chiffré TLS 1.3 et les tokens d’authentification sont stockés dans le keystore natif (Keychain pour iOS, EncryptedSharedPreferences pour Android). La conformité GDPR impose une gestion granulaire du consentement, notamment pour les notifications push qui incitent les joueurs à revenir sur le jackpot.
Enfin, l’optimisation des performances graphiques repose sur le batching des draw calls et la réduction des textures inutiles. Sur Flutter, on exploite les widgets “RepaintBoundary” pour éviter le redraw complet lors d’une mise à jour du compteur de jackpot. Sur React Native, le bridge JavaScript‑native est limité à des appels courts ; les calculs de probabilité du jackpot sont donc délégués à du code natif Swift/Kotlin.
2. Optimisation de l’expérience utilisateur (UX) pour les jackpots mobiles
Le parcours commence dès l’ouverture de l’application : l’écran d’accueil propose un carrousel de jeux avec un badge “Jackpot + €5 M”. Un tap ouvre une prévisualisation où le joueur peut voir le montant actuel, le nombre de contributeurs et le temps restant avant le prochain tirage. Cette transparence crée une attente contrôlée, essentielle pour réduire le churn.
Le design adaptatif doit prendre en compte la fragmentation des tailles d’écran. Sur les smartphones de 5 pouces, les boutons de mise sont agrandis et disposés en ligne horizontale pour faciliter le pouce. Sur les tablettes, on passe à une grille à trois colonnes, avec un aperçu vidéo du jackpot qui se lance automatiquement en arrière‑plan. Les gestes de glissement permettent de faire défiler les lignes de paiement, tandis que le double‑tap active le “quick spin” avec la mise maximale prédéfinie.
La latence est le principal ennemi du joueur de jackpot. Pour la réduire, on pré‑charge les assets de l’animation pendant les écrans de transition et on utilise le “progressive loading” : les premiers cadres de la roue sont affichés dès que le serveur confirme le paiement, le reste se charge en arrière‑plan. Les temps de chargement moyens se situent ainsi autour de 1,2 s sur iOS et 1,5 s sur Android, ce qui reste acceptable pour un jeu à forte intensité visuelle.
La personnalisation s’appuie sur le machine‑learning. Un modèle de clustering analyse le montant moyen des mises, la fréquence de jeu et le temps passé sur les jackpots. Il propose ensuite des offres ciblées, comme 10 free spins supplémentaires si le joueur n’a pas touché le jackpot depuis 48 h, ou un cashback de 5 % sur les mises du jour. Ces incitations sont délivrées via des notifications push qui affichent le compteur du jackpot en temps réel, renforçant le sentiment d’urgence.
3. Stratégies d’acquisition et de rétention centrées sur les jackpots
Les campagnes publicitaires diffèrent selon le store. Sur iOS, Apple Search Ads permet de placer les mots‑clés « jackpot », « progressif » et « bonus » en haut des résultats de recherche, avec un coût par acquisition souvent supérieur mais un ARPU plus élevé grâce à la propension à dépenser des utilisateurs premium. Sur Android, Google UAC (Universal App Campaign) cible les utilisateurs qui ont déjà installé des jeux de hasard, en utilisant le signal “high‑value players” pour optimiser les impressions.
Les programmes de bonus mobiles se déclinent en deux formes : des free spins dédiés aux jackpots (ex. 20 spins sur “Mega Fortune” avec un gain potentiel de €2 M) et du cash‑back quotidien limité à 10 % du volume de mise sur les jeux à jackpot. Ces offres sont affichées dans un tableau de bord “My Bonus” accessible depuis le menu principal.
Le “progressive jackpot timer” est un élément psychologique puissant. Il indique, en temps réel, le nombre de tours restants avant le prochain tirage automatique (par ex. « 3 tours avant le reset »). En combinant ce timer avec une offre « doublez votre mise si vous jouez dans les 30 secondes suivantes », les opérateurs créent une pression temporelle qui augmente le taux de conversion de 12 % en moyenne.
Les KPI à surveiller incluent l’ARPU (revenu moyen par utilisateur), le LTV (valeur vie client) et le taux de rétention à 7 jours (D7). Sur iOS, le D7 est souvent de 45 %, contre 38 % sur Android, ce qui justifie des budgets publicitaires légèrement plus élevés pour le premier.
4. Gestion des exigences légales et de la conformité mobile
Le jeu responsable est obligatoire sur les deux stores. L’âge minimum (18 ans en Europe) est vérifié via l’API d’identification de l’appareil, et une case à cocher « Je confirme mon âge » apparaît dès le premier lancement. Le self‑exclusion est intégré à l’application : un bouton « Auto‑exclure » bloque immédiatement l’accès aux jeux et déclenche une notification push de confirmation.
Les jackpots doivent être certifiés par les autorités compétentes. La UK Gambling Commission (UKGC) exige une documentation détaillée du RNG et du calcul du jackpot, tandis que la Malta Gaming Authority (MGA) vérifie la transparence du pool de contribution. Les licences sont stockées dans le backend et mises à jour automatiquement lorsqu’une mise à jour d’OS modifie les exigences de cryptage.
Chaque mise à jour d’iOS ou d’Android peut impacter la conformité. Par exemple, iOS 17 a introduit de nouvelles restrictions sur les publicités liées au jeu, obligeant les développeurs à déclarer explicitement le type de promotion dans le champ “ad‑network”. Google Play, de son côté, a renforcé la politique de “data‑safety” qui requiert un tableau détaillé des données collectées, y compris les habitudes de jeu.
Pour éviter les rejets en Store Review, il est recommandé de préparer un dossier de conformité contenant : la licence de jeu, le plan de jeu responsable, les captures d’écran des flux de paiement, et un test d’accessibilité. Cette documentation simplifie le processus de validation et réduit le temps de mise en ligne de nouvelles versions.
5. Analyse comparative des performances des jackpots iOS vs Android
Les données internes montrent que le taux de conversion des joueurs qui atteignent le jackpot est de 3,2 % sur iOS contre 2,7 % sur Android. Cette différence s’explique en partie par la puissance du GPU Apple A15, qui rend les animations de roue plus fluides, augmentant la perception de légitimité du gain.
Le matériel influence également le temps de rendu : sur un iPhone 13 Pro, la séquence de 360° du jackpot se charge en 0,8 s, alors que sur un Samsung Galaxy S21, le même rendu prend 1,1 s. Les jeux qui utilisent des shaders complexes (ex. “Mega Jackpot Deluxe”) performent mieux sur iOS, tandis que les titres plus légers (ex. “Lucky Spin”) affichent des chiffres similaires sur les deux plateformes.
Un cas d’étude : le jeu “Fortune Wheel” a vu son revenu moyen par joueur passer de €12,3 à €15,6 après optimisation du rendu pour Android via le mode “GPU‑Profiling” de Unity. L’amélioration a réduit les saccades et a permis d’augmenter le nombre moyen de spins par session de 18 % à 24 %.
Pour équilibrer les performances, il est conseillé d’utiliser une couche d’abstraction qui détecte le type de GPU et ajuste dynamiquement la résolution des textures du jackpot. Par exemple, passer de 4 K à 1080p sur les appareils Android de milieu de gamme conserve l’effet visuel tout en réduisant la charge processeur.
6. Road‑map de développement : du prototype à la mise en production cross‑plateforme
- Phase de recherche (4 semaines) – Analyse du marché, benchmark des jackpots existants, définition des exigences fonctionnelles et de conformité.
- MVP (8 semaines) – Prototype fonctionnel avec un seul jeu à jackpot, intégration du paiement Apple Pay/Google Pay, tests unitaires de la logique RNG.
- Bêta fermée (6 semaines) – Déploiement sur TestFlight et Google Play Internal Test, collecte de feedback UX, itération sur les animations et le timer du jackpot.
- Lancement global (4 semaines) – Publication dans les stores, campagne ASO et publicitaire, monitoring des KPI en temps réel.
Les tests automatisés couvrent : les appels API (Postman), l’UI (Appium), et les performances (Xcode Instruments, Android Profiler). Les pipelines CI/CD s’appuient sur Fastlane pour la signature des builds, Bitrise pour le parallélisme Android/iOS, et Azure Pipelines pour la gestion des environnements de staging.
Après le lancement, le suivi post‑production inclut : surveillance du taux d’erreur 5xx, alertes de latence du jackpot, hot‑fixes via des releases “over‑the‑air”. Les itérations suivantes introduisent de nouveaux jackpots progressifs, des options de personnalisation et des programmes de fidélité basés sur les données collectées.
Conclusion
Une stratégie mobile efficace pour les jackpots repose sur une architecture technique robuste, capable de délivrer des animations haute définition tout en respectant les standards PCI‑DSS et GDPR. L’expérience utilisateur doit être fluide, adaptative et enrichie de mécanismes de personnalisation qui transforment chaque spin en une opportunité de gain. La conformité légale, du jeu responsable aux exigences des stores, constitue le socle qui garantit la pérennité du produit. Enfin, l’analyse comparative des performances iOS/Android permet d’ajuster les ressources et d’optimiser le ROI.
En appliquant ces bonnes pratiques – du choix du framework à la feuille de route de déploiement – les opérateurs peuvent créer des expériences de casino mobile qui captivent, retiennent et, surtout, génèrent des jackpots mémorables. Pour approfondir certains aspects techniques ou consulter des ressources supplémentaires, n’hésitez pas à visiter Myveggie, qui propose une collection d’articles de référence sur le développement mobile et la conformité réglementaire.
Références : Myveggie (site de ressources), documentation officielle iOS/Android, guides PCI‑DSS.
